Dom Perignon Brut IPA pours a restrained golden color with small champagne-like bubbles. Aromas of almond and powdered cocoa gradually develop into hints of white fruit and dried flowers. Up front it features refreshing flavors of ripe fruit, strawberry, guava, violet and vanilla. It then transitions into complex blends of honeysuckle, orange, pomegranate and toasted almonds. It finishes with a biting energy and touch of smokiness. The mouthfeel treads a delicate boundary between weightlessness and intense gravity, with an aftertaste that elegantly lingers on a spicy note. Aging in French oak canoes for 11 months has served to accentuate the malt profile while smoothing out the finish considerably. While $329 may seem expensive for a 4-pack, the quality you are getting with each sip is unmatched anywhere in the world.
